Output 17f8b1fdc8b3ba561dabffefa588a23f50f906da0f18b2c102f942aec83abf59:1

value
17616370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 067e8916e7479a92c2b2d7a5aaae1abc1290e619 OP_EQUALVERIFY OP_CHECKSIG
address
1bLdzYGE5phub5BDTekcnox5Wd2hizjwa
transaction
17f8b1fdc8b3ba561dabffefa588a23f50f906da0f18b2c102f942aec83abf59
spent
true